A bright, newly renovated three-bedroom terraced townhouse arranged over three floors, set on an unusually large plot in Northallerton. The ground floor opens to a contemporary open-plan kitchen/dining space and a roomy living room with large windows that flood the home with natural light. Off-street parking via a private driveway adds practical convenience for families.
The top-floor principal bedroom is particularly generous (7.77 x 2.81m) and adaptable as a master suite, playroom or teenage retreat. Two further bedrooms on the first floor work well for children or a home office, while a family-sized bathroom on the first floor features modern fixtures. The property is freehold, a new build and has been newly renovated throughout, so immediate move-in is realistic.
Notable practical points: there is a single bathroom serving three bedrooms, and the kitchen/dining area is modest in footprint (2.53 x 3.84m) compared with the overall home size. Council tax banding hasn’t yet been released by the authority. The area is described as an ageing rural neighbourhood within an affluent wider area — helpful for buyers seeking quieter streets but potentially reflecting a mixed age profile locally.
Overall this home suits growing families needing flexible space, convenient parking and low-maintenance new-build finishes. The unusually large plot offers future landscaping or garden-use potential, while its newly updated condition reduces short-term refurbishment needs.
